Effects of Tire Temperature on Performance

The temperature of a Green Max tire has a significant impact on its performance, particularly in extreme weather conditions. When the tire is operating in a warmer environment, its tread compound and tire pressure can affect its rolling resistance, friction, and overall traction. As a result, it’s essential to ensure that tire temperature is within the optimal range for safe driving conditions.

“Tire temperature is a critical factor in determining the performance of a Green Max tire. When a tire is subjected to high temperatures, its tread compound can break down, reducing traction and braking performance.”

To maintain optimal tire temperature, drivers should ensure that their tires are properly inflated and regularly check for signs of overheating. Additionally, drivers can adjust their driving habits to maintain a stable speed and avoid extreme acceleration or braking, which can cause tire temperature to rise.

Design of a Tire Comparison Test

A well-designed tire comparison test should include a combination of laboratory and real-world testing to assess the performance of Green Max tires in various conditions. This can be achieved by using a standardized testing protocol that evaluates the following key performance indicators (KPIs):

  • Braking performance: This includes testing the stopping distance of the vehicle equipped with Green Max tires in both dry and wet conditions.
  • Handling and stability: This involves assessing the vehicle’s ability to corner and maintain stability at various speeds.
  • Tire wear: This can be evaluated by measuring the tread depth and surface wear of the tire after a specified distance or time.
  • Road noise: This can be measured using sound level meters to assess the noise level generated by the tire during various driving scenarios.

These KPIs provide a comprehensive picture of the Green Max tire’s performance and enable a fair comparison with other tire brands.
